How To Choose The Best Gag Gifts
Choosing the best gag gift is a delicate art of reading the room and understanding the joke. You need to consider the audience, the setting, and the durability of the humor itself to avoid a misfire.
Durability Beyond the First Laugh
Look beyond a single photo or punchline. The best gag gifts have “shelf life”—they are conversation pieces on a desk, a source of repeat amusement in a bathroom, or a functional item with a hilarious twist. Products made from sturdy resin, strong paper stock, or with integrated electronics (like a talking toy) will outlive the initial reveal and provide lasting entertainment.
Matching the Sarcasm and Shock Levels
Gag gifts range from cheeky and clever (fake world facts) to blatantly irreverent (middle finger statues). Gauge your recipient’s comfort zone. A sarcastic calendar may be perfect for a cynical coworker, while a loud, sassy talking pickle might be the chaotic energy for a close friend’s party. Too tame is a dud; too aggressive is a disaster.
Practicality Meets Absurdity
The best gag gifts blend usefulness with the absurd. A notepad that looks like a trash can fire is both a functional office supply and a daily inside joke. A book of useless facts serves its purpose on the throne while being a brilliant conversation starter. If an item combines a function (writing, telling time, storing things) with a ridiculous twist, it earns its keep.

1. Mystic Pickle – Magic Fortune Teller
The Mystic Pickle is the undisputed heavyweight champion of interactive gag gifts. This isn’t a passive figurine; it’s a battery-powered oracle with over 100 witty, sassy, and surprisingly profound audio responses. Its compact resin-and-silicone body houses a personality that turns any party, dinner table, or office breakroom into a comedy show. The responses range from sarcastic to encouraging, and the loud, clear audio ensures nobody misses the punchline.
Finished with a bright yellow pickle aesthetic, the device feels solid and well-balanced in hand. The included three LR44 batteries mean it’s ready to deliver its first prophecy straight out of the box. Reviewers consistently note that it outperforms traditional magic eight balls in terms of sheer fun and audience engagement, becoming the centerpiece of gatherings rather than a background object.

4. Infmetry Garbage Can Fire Sticky Notes
These sticky notes are the undisputed king of the office white elephant gift. The concept is wonderfully simple: sticky note pads printed with a 3D design that looks like a small trash can upon which a fire rages. Place one on a monitor, a desk, or a filing cabinet, and it instantly transforms a boring office space into a daily joke about “putting out fires” or “this meeting is a dumpster fire.”
The set includes two pads—one yellow, one red—totaling 300 sheets. The “super sticky” adhesive quality is confirmed by reviews, with users noting they stick firmly to monitors and desk surfaces without curling at the edges or leaving residue when removed. The 3D print effect is more convincing than a standard flat print, creating a dimensional look that earns double-takes from new viewers.
Because it’s genuinely functional, this gift is a “safe” gag—hilarious without being mean or offensive. It’s a perfect choice for new hires, bosses, or coworkers you barely know, providing a daily chuckle without crossing any personal boundaries or requiring specific inside knowledge.
